《我的世界》多人服务器搭建是玩家实现跨平台联机、自定义地图及社交互动的核心方式。本文从硬件准备到配置优化,详细讲解PC/主机/手机端联机设置方法,涵盖防火墙配置、地图编辑技巧、反作弊策略及热门玩法设计,助您快速创建安全稳定的多人服务器。
【一、搭建基础准备】
硬件与软件需求
服务器硬件需满足4GB内存起步,推荐使用NVIDIA/AMD显卡
操作系统:Windows 10/11或Linux系统(主机端需额外配置)
必备工具:Java 1.17+版本、Eclipse或IntelliJ IDEA开发环境
跨平台方案:使用MC-Server、Spigot或PaperMC等主流服务器软件
网络环境优化
建议使用有线宽带连接(推荐100M以上带宽)
关闭后台占用带宽程序(如下载软件、视频流)
检测路由器端口转发设置(UGC端口8192/8012/25565)
【二、基础配置流程】
3. 服务器安装与启动
下载对应版本服务器包(PC端推荐使用JAR文件)
通过终端执行"java -jar server.jar"命令启动
初次启动需等待15-30分钟完成世界生成
核心参数设置
添加启动参数:-Xmx4G(分配4G内存)-Dcom.mojang.eula acceptanceTerm="true"
配置Motd公告:"欢迎来到XX服务器!生存模式/创造模式可选"
启用PVP模式:server.properties文件中设置pvp=true
【三、跨平台联机设置】
5. 网络配置方案
PC/主机联机:通过IP地址或域名访问(需路由器端口映射)
手机端联机:使用MCPE客户端扫描二维码或输入服务器地址
多平台混合联机:配置MC-Server的CrossPlatformSupport参数
安全防护设置
启用白名单功能:server.properties设置white-list=true
添加IP封禁列表:通过控制台执行/banlist add
安装反作弊插件:推荐使用Anti-Cheat或NoCheatPlus
【四、进阶玩法开发】
7. 地图编辑技巧
使用MapEdit工具创建初始地图(推荐3km²地形)
添加自定义指令:/function <函数名> run command...
设计动态事件:通过红石电路触发怪物生成/掉落
社交功能配置
开启权限系统:安装PermissionsEx或Groups插件
设置VIP等级:创建不同权限组(管理员/会员/访客)
开发聊天系统:配置chat.type.*指令过滤规则
【五、性能优化指南】
9. 服务器性能调优
优化内存分配:调整-Xmx参数至可用内存的70%
启用线程池优化:修改PaperMC的thread-pool-size配置
使用懒加载技术:配置Paper的 entity-limits.max实体数量
自动化运维方案
设置定时任务:通过cron表达式执行备份操作
安装监控插件:使用Metrics或SPGWatch监控CPU/内存
开发控制面板:基于Web接口实现远程管理
【总结与建议】
搭建《我的世界》多人服务器需系统规划硬件配置、网络设置及安全防护。建议新手从基础配置入手,逐步扩展到地图编辑与插件开发。定期更新服务器版本(推荐每季度升级一次),保持插件兼容性。对于大型服务器,可考虑使用云服务器(推荐AWS/Azure)并配置DDoS防护。
【常见问题解答】
如何实现PC与主机跨平台联机?
答:需在主机端安装MC-Server并配置CrossPlatformSupport参数,PC端使用Java版客户端。
服务器卡顿如何优化?
答:检查内存分配是否合理,关闭不必要的插件,使用异步加载优化红石电路。
如何创建付费会员系统?
答:安装PermissionsEx插件,通过MySQL数据库实现会员等级与权限绑定。
手机端如何远程管理服务器?
答:使用MC-Server的Web控制台功能,或通过第三方控制面板(如MCControl)。
怎样防止刷怪卡服务器?
答:安装NoCheatPlus插件,设置怪物生成频率限制(如 entity生成上限为50)。
服务器崩溃后如何恢复?
答:定期备份世界文件(使用Wago或手动导出),检查Java版本兼容性。
如何设置服务器广告位?
答:在Motd公告中插入HTML代码,或使用Scoreboard插件显示广告标语。
多人合作建造技巧有哪些?
答:创建协作权限组,使用/follow指令跟随队友,配置共享建造坐标。